Hill has claimed the woman tripped over a puppy.

Tyreek Hill has disputed the account of model Sophie Hall, who claims that Hill broke her leg while running drills at the NFL player's home. Hill's lawyer has claimed that Hall instead tripped over a puppy, causing her to break her leg. Hall's original lawsuit does note that a dog interrupted the activity but did not state that Hall tripped over the animal. Furthermore, Hill's representation noted that there was a pending insurance claim on his home and that the wide receiver already intended to cover Hall's medical bills.

Hall's original lawsuit, filed earlier this week, alleges that Hill "charged into her violently and with great force, resulting in significant and serious injuries." This, according to the lawsuit, was because she "knocked him back" during the drills, causing him to become "angry" and "embarrassed". Hall is seeking between $50,000 and $75,000 and has demanded a jury trial to resolve the matter. This remains a developing story.

Tyreek Hill Fires Employee Responsible For Divorce Filing

Furthermore, it's not been a peaceful start to 2024 for Hill. Hill fired a "f-cking bonehead" who filed a divorce for the wide receiver without his consent. "I just gotta say that it sucks that A, yeah, a lot of our stuff is public record. But behind closed doors, a lot of people got fired, too, for just doing things without a 'yes.' It sucks that me and my wife gotta go through that. Like yeah, public records says it and right now we're in a spot of fixing it -- I fired the f-cking bonehead that did that mistake. Now it sucks," Hill said on a livestream in January.

Hill married Keeta Vaccaro during the Dolphins' bye week and gifted her a game ball after scoring a touchdown a few games later. However, the young marriage has faced serious strain as three women filed paternity suits against Hill. All three children were reportedly born in 2023 and conceived in 2022. If all cases are legitimate, this would mean Hill fathered all three children while engaged to Vaccaro.
